7.62 x 51 brass reloaded to 308

I have a chance to buy a lot of 7.62 x 51 brass once fired pretty cheap, can I full length size it to 308 and run it through my M1A and AR10? Its not the greatest head stamp but most matches I shoot are lost brass matches anyway and I don't like giving up my LC brass.
 
Yes. A year or two ago, I resized 3000 LC for my various 308s, including my M1A and DPMS SASS.

When you run it through your 308 Win dies it will be 308 Win. For shooting in a M1A you need to set up the sizing die to maintain proper headspace. If the headspace is too long "slam fires" become a possibility. You'll also need to trim this military brass and likely decrimp the primer pockets.
